Even when using the i-Type film, the price per picture will be $2, since a pack of 8 costs $16.

Can use the cheaper, battery-less i-Type film
The OneStep 2 can use Polaroid Original's Color 600 film (that comes with a battery in the film pack) or i-Type film (without battery, cheaper). The reason why this camera can use the i-Type film is because it has a built-in rechargeable (via USB) battery, avoiding the need for one in the film pack. This means you can save some money by using the cheaper film.

Different shutter speeds for different needs
This camera has multiple shutter speed modes. For example, the "Party" mode lets more light in, while the "Kids" mode uses a shorter shutter speed, to better create a "frozen" image effect.
